Eyeglass temples: How do you know if they're the right length? Temple length is measured in millimeters (mm) and most frames have temples that range in length from 120 to 150 mm. The temples of the frame should be long enough so they can be bent downward at about a 45-degree angle at a point just beyond the top of your ears. About 30 to 45 mm of the temple should extend beyond this bend point and be adjusted to conform closely to the contour of your head behind your ear.
